Job description

Overview

The Radiologic Technologist I is responsible for performing duties involving the taking of radiographs and fluoroscopic examinations of various portions of the body.

Special Instructions

Orthopedic Clinic Radiology Technician

Responsibilities
  • Receives patient and checks x‑ray form to determine type and extent of examination involved. Secures records and reports for patients who have been examined previously.
  • Secures patients from and returns to proper areas upon completion of x‑ray examination or treatment.
  • Assists patient in preparation for examination and insures physical position for required exposure for all types of radiology.
  • Performs and/or assists with radiographic and fluoroscopic procedures while maintaining optimum patient safety.
  • May mix and administer chemical mixtures orally or as enemas to render organs of the body more opaque.
  • In accordance with prescribed procedures, may be required to develop exposed film. Prepare and replace developing and fixing solutions according to standard formulas.
  • Maintains films and records as required.
  • Reports all problems in equipment to Director as appropriate.
  • May schedule patient appointments when clerk‑typist is not on duty.
  • Performs recordkeeping pertaining to the job.
  • May assist Radiologist in making special examinations.
  • May be required to operate mobile x‑ray machine in Operating and Emergency Room or at bedside.
  • Retrieves and returns isotopes or radium to proper storage area.
  • Prepares and operates equipment for radiation therapy and records appropriate data.
  • Determines if levels of free radiation are within limits of safety in storage or area of use.
  • May prepare opaque compounds for IV administration by physician/radiologist.
  • Must rotate on‑call as required.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
